are there whole numbers that are not rational numbers.

All negative integers are rational numbers but those are not whole numbers. For example -3 is a rational number (can be expressed as -3/1), but it is not a whole number. The fractions like 1/2, -3/4,22/7 etc. are rational numbers, but these are not whole numbers.
